Hardware Requirements for POS Integration

An effective POS integration for loyalty platforms India begins at the hardware layer, where stability, scalability, and compatibility govern performance. Typically, Indian retail chains use a combination of on-premise POS devices and cloud-based terminals. Brands like GoFrugal and POSist dominate, offering robust hardware that supports barcode scanning, RFID, biometric authentication, and NFC payments.

Hardware must handle high throughput in busy malls such as Phoenix Marketcity Mumbai or Select CITYWALK Delhi. The strategy includes ensuring devices have adequate RAM (minimum 4GB) and processors (Intel Core i3+ or ARM Cortex equivalents) to process loyalty logic locally during intermittent network outages. Peripheral hardware, too—printers, card readers, and network routers—must guarantee minimal latency to maintain smooth queue management.

Power backup and redundancy are critical given frequent power fluctuations in many Indian retail zones. Integration-ready hardware is certified to work with middleware layers for data transmission. Additionally, multi-store chains often deploy edge devices or IoT gateways to aggregate POS data securely before syncing with centralized loyalty databases, ensuring compliance with data governance policies across states. Retail CIOs must validate hardware firmware compatibility with loyalty software updates to avoid integration failures.

Software Components and Middleware

POS integration for loyalty platforms India relies heavily on a layered software architecture. At the base, an efficient POS software layer manages transaction data including SKU details, quantities, and payment modes. Indian retailers frequently use customized POS software modules embedded with loyalty triggers. Middleware acts as the conduit between the POS and loyalty platform, offering data transformation, queuing, and event buffering.

Middleware solutions such as Apache Kafka streams or RabbitMQ are leveraged to ensure no data loss and allow asynchronous processing that mitigates latency risks. These middleware layers also reconcile offline transactions when network connectivity is restored. Custom-built wrappers or adapters translate data into standardized APIs used by loyalty engines like Fundle Loyalty or comparable offerings from Capillary and EasyRewardz.

Beyond messaging, workflow engines embedded in middleware automate loyalty logic application—calculating points, applying tier upgrades, or allocating rewards per business rules defined for brands like FabIndia or Manyavar. Middleware also enforces transaction validation to eliminate fraud and performs currency conversions in multi-lingual, multi-region scenarios. Effective middleware ensures scalability across thousands of daily interactions without degrading customer-facing responsiveness.

API Gateways and Security Layers

Security and reliability in POS integration for loyalty platforms India are non-negotiable. API Gateways serve as the frontline, controlling access to backend loyalty services and shielding sensitive transaction data from malicious actors. Indian retailers must conform to PCI DSS standards alongside local data privacy regulations, such as the Personal Data Protection Bill.

The API gateway enforces authentication, authorization, encryption (TLS 1.2+), and throttling measures to guarantee uptime during peak sale seasons such as Diwali and Republic Day. Rate limiting prevents API abuse from fraudulent POS requests. Key management and tokenization safeguard customer identities while also enabling secure loyalty point transactions.

Indian retail operators deploy API managers integrated with identity providers using OAuth2 protocols to federate credential management. Audit trails within the security layers log transaction histories to assist compliance and fraud investigations. Security monitoring also includes anomaly detection engines often enhanced by AI models embedded in the Fundle AI Workflow, which continuously assess risk scores associated with transactions and API calls.

Step-by-Step Playbook to Integrate POS with Loyalty Programs

01

Assess Current POS and Loyalty Systems

Map existing POS hardware and software capabilities alongside the loyalty platform’s integration readiness and protocol compatibility.

02

Select Middleware and API Strategy

Implement middleware solutions that manage data ingestion reliably, and design API contracts supporting real-time communication and offline caching.

03

Develop and Test Integration Modules

Build adapters to parse POS data formats, test transaction flows, and validate loyalty rule execution across multiple store scenarios.

04

Establish Security and Compliance Framework

Deploy API gateways with encryption, authentication, and monitoring layers, aligning with PCI DSS and Indian data protection mandates.

05

Deploy AI Analytics and Optimize

Activate analytics dashboards and AI agents to monitor program effectiveness, customer engagement, and identify growth opportunities.

Frequently asked

What are the common challenges in integrating Indian POS systems with loyalty platforms?+

Key challenges include heterogeneous hardware, varying data formats, network instability, and compliance with evolving data regulations across Indian states.

How can middleware improve POS and loyalty platform integration?+

Middleware ensures data reliability through buffering, transformation, and asynchronous communication, thus handling offline transactions and reducing latency.

Is AI integration necessary for effective loyalty program management?+

AI enhances personalization, fraud detection, and churn prediction, transforming loyalty programs from static rewards to dynamic engagement engines.

Which security protocols are essential for API gateways in POS-loyalty integration?+

TLS encryption, OAuth2 authentication, PCI DSS compliance, and real-time monitoring are vital to secure POS and loyalty transactions.

Can existing POS hardware be used for loyalty integration?+

Most modern POS systems in India support integration-ready interfaces; however, legacy hardware may require adapters or phased upgrades.
